What is a security operations center?

A Security Operations Center (SOC) job involves monitoring, detecting, analyzing, and responding to cybersecurity threats in real time. SOC analysts use various security tools to identify suspicious activities, mitigate risks, and protect an organization's digital assets. They work in a team environment, following incident response protocols to contain threats and prevent breaches. SOC professionals also conduct vulnerability assessments, generate reports, and collaborate with other IT teams to strengthen security defenses. The role requires knowledge of cybersecurity principles, threat intelligence, and security technologies.

What does a typical workday look like for someone in a security operations center role?

A typical day in a Security Operations Center involves monitoring network activity for suspicious behavior, responding to real-time security incidents, and conducting daily threat analysis using specialized software. SOC professionals often work in shifts within a collaborative, fast-paced team environment where quick decision-making and constant vigilance are required. Tasks may also include generating incident reports, performing vulnerability assessments, and coordinating with other departments to strengthen organizational security. This dynamic, hands-on role provides valuable experience and can serve as a strong foundation for advancing into more specialized cybersecurity posit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the security operations center position?

To thrive in a Security Operations Center, you need strong analytical abilities, a solid understanding of cybersecurity principles, and typically a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with SIEM (Security Information and Event Management) tools, intrusion detection/prevention systems, and certifications like CompTIA Security+, CISSP, or CEH are highly valued. Attention to detail, effective communication, and the ability to remain calm under pressure are crucial soft skills. These competencies enable professionals to quickly detect, analyze, and mitigate security threats while collaborating efficiently with IT and management teams.

Is a Security Operations Center an entry level job?

A Security Operations Center (SOC) analyst role can be entry level, especially for positions requiring basic knowledge of cybersecurity principles, monitoring tools, and incident response. However, many SOC roles prefer candidates with some experience, certifications like CompTIA Security+ or Cisco CCNA, and familiarity with security information and event management (SIEM) systems. Advancement often involves gaining experience and additional certifications.

What does a security operations center do?

A Security Operations Center (SOC) monitors and analyzes an organization’s security posture using tools like intrusion detection systems, firewalls, and security information and event management (SIEM) software. SOC analysts detect, respond to, and mitigate cybersecurity threats and incidents to protect critical systems and data around the clock.

Amazon.com, Inc., commonly known as Amazon, is an American multinational technology company. It was foun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994 and initially started as an online marketplace for books. Since then, Amazon has expanded its operations and become one of the largest e-commerce companies in the world. Amazon's primary business is its online retail platform, where customers can purchase a vast array of products, including electronics, clothing, books, home goods, and much more. The company offers a convenient and user-friendly shopping experience, with features such as fast shipping, customer reviews, and personalized recommendations. In addition to its e-commerce platform, Amazon has diversified its business into various other areas. One of its notable ventures is Amazon Web Services (AWS), a comprehensive cloud computing platform that provides services such as storage, compute power, and database management to individuals and businesses. AWS has become a leader in the cloud computing industry, powering many websites and applications worldwide. Amazon has also developed its own consumer electronics, including the popular Amazon Kindle e-reader, Fire tablets, Fire TV streaming devices, and the Alexa-powered Echo smart speakers. The Alexa voice assistant, integrated into these devices, allows users to interact with their devices using voice commands, perform tasks, and access information. Furthermore, Amazon has expanded into media and entertainment. It operates Prime Video, a streaming service that offers a wide range of movies, TV shows, and original content. Amazon Music provides a platform for streaming and purchasing digital music, while Audible offers audiobooks and other audio content. The company's commitment to customer satisfaction and convenience is demonstrated by its membership program, Amazon Prime. Prime members receive various benefits, including free two-day shipping, access to streaming services, exclusive deals, and more.
